Mats Wilander defeated Ivan Lendl in the final, 6–1, 6–4, 6–4 to win the men's singles tennis title at the 1983 Australian Open. It was his first Australian Open title and second major singles title overall.
Johan Kriek was the two-time defending champion, but lost in the quarterfinals to Wilander.
